Engineering Compliance Across International Standards
Structural projects crossing borders demand that plate grades satisfy the governing design code at destination — EN 1993 for European builds, AISC 360 for North American contracts, and local bridge codes for infrastructure works. S235JR, S275JR, and S355JR under EN 10025 cover the general structural spectrum, while A516 GR.60 and GR.70 address pressure vessel applications requiring improved notch toughness. For EU-bound shipments, CE marking per EN 10025 with Factory Production Control documentation clears customs without hold-ups, whereas ASTM A36 plates heading to North American sites require full MTC documentation traceable to heat number. Hot Rolling Chemistry and Surface Readiness
The hot rolling process heats slab above recrystallization temperature, producing a mill scale surface that we remove through acid pickling followed by light oiling to prevent flash rust during transit. This treatment delivers a chemically clean base suitable for direct welding without pre-cleaning, critical when your fabrication shop needs to execute WPS-qualified weld procedures on S355JR plates without delay. The yield strength hierarchy — S235JR at the baseline, S275JR for moderate loading, S355JR for heavy structural frames — lets engineers optimize section weight against design loads. Across the ASTM system, A36 serves general construction while A516 grades target elevated-temperature service in boiler and pressure vessel applications. Thickness from 1.5 mm to 4.0 mm covers light gauge cladding support through medium plate for gusset and connection applications, with the ±1% tolerance ensuring that theoretical weight calculations match actual delivered mass for accurate project costing.
Hidden Costs of Unverified Plate Procurement
Ordering S355 plates from an unverified source might save a few dollars per ton on paper, but the real costs emerge during fabrication and inspection. Plates with chemistry outside the EN 10025 range for S355JR will fail weld procedure qualification testing, forcing re-order and schedule delays that dwarf the initial savings. Thickness tolerance exceeding ±1% means connection plates arrive undersized, requiring re-machining or outright rejection at the bolt-up stage. Missing or fabricated MTC documents trigger customs holds at destination ports — and when an ASTM A36 S355 hot rolled carbon steel plate arrives without proper EN 10204 3.1 certification for a European project, the entire shipment sits bonded until supplementary testing clears the material. Q: How do ASTM A36, S235JR, and Q235B compare across different standard systems?
A: These three grades represent the general structural carbon steel category under ASTM (US), EN (European), and GB (Chinese) standards respectively. All three deliver comparable yield strength levels suitable for building frames, platforms, and general fabrication. The key differences lie in chemical composition limits, impact testing requirements, and certification documentation format. Q: What is the difference between acid pickled, hot rolled black, and shot-blasted plus primed plates?
A: Acid pickled and oiled plates arrive with mill scale removed and a light oil film preventing flash rust — ready for direct welding or painting. Hot rolled black plates retain the as-rolled mill scale surface, suitable for applications where surface preparation will occur at your workshop. Shot-blasted and primed plates arrive with surface profile prepared and shop primer applied, reducing your site preparation time. The choice depends on your fabrication sequence and coating specification.
